Question

In the fcc structure, the number of tetrahedral holes per sphere is

Options

  1. A. 1
  2. B. 4
  3. C. 2
  4. D. 8

Answer

C. 2

Step-by-step solution

In a face-centered cubic (fcc) unit cell, the total number of atoms (spheres) is 4. The tetrahedral voids are located on the body diagonals of the cube. There are 4 body diagonals and each body diagonal contains 2 tetrahedral voids. Total number of tetrahedral voids in an fcc unit cell = 4 2 = 8. Number of tetrahedral holes per sphere = 8 4 = 2. Answer: 2
